The
Wellcome Trust Genome Campus is located 10 miles/25 minutes
drive south of central Cambridge close to the M11 motorway
and the main train lines linking London to Cambridge.
However note that taxis to Hinxton tend to be expensive
- more economical public transportation to Hinxton from
major airports or London requires a multi-part journey
involving tube/train or bus and then bus or taxi.
Directions
by Road
By
car from the South: Leave the M11 at junction
9 and take the A1301 towards Cambridge. From the Stumps
Cross roundabout system take the first left (about 800m).
At the next small roundabout follow the signpost for
'Genome Campus'
By
car from the North: Leave the M11 at junction
10 (note that M11 junction 9 is restricted and only accessible
from the South). Travel a mile or so (straight on at the
first small roundabout) on the A505 in the direction of
Saffron Walden. At the second roundabout take the third
exit (signed A1301 towards Saffron Walden). Pass two turnings
to Hinxton (these go to the village only), and take the
next right, at a small roundabout, signposted to the Genome
Campus. (see maps below)
By
train/taxi: Closest local station to Hinxton
with a taxi rank service is Audley End
station (four miles south of Hinxton) on the London Liverpool
Street to Cambridge line. Journey times to Audley End
from London (1 hour) and Stansted Airport (12 min). Timetables
available from National
Rail. Taxis from Audley End to Hinxton are about £20
Travel
from Heathrow / Gatwick Airports
National
Express Coach Lines provides direct service from major airports
(Heathrow, Gatwick, Stansted
as well as London, Manchester etc ) to the Drummer
Street Bus Station in Cambridge [timetables/fares]
You can then take a taxi (£20-25 one way as of Sep
'07).
If
you chose to go by rail via London from Heathrow or Gatwick:
Heathrow Terminal 1,2 or 3:
Take the Heathrow Express to Paddington, then the
tube to Liverpool Street and the train to Audley End
Heathrow Terminal 4:
Take the tube to Liverpool Street and the train to Audley
End
Gatwick: Take the
Kings Cross Thameslink to Kings Cross and train to Cambridge
OR tube to Liverpool Street and the train to Audley End.
Quick
Reference: Recommended routes
From London: train
to Audley End from Liverpool Street Station / taxi to Hinxton
From Cambridge: taxi to Hinxton
From Stansted: train
to Audley End / taxi to Hinxton
From Heathrow/Gatwick and major UK cities: coach
to Cambridge / taxi
to Hinxton
